Pink opal

Pink Opal is a variety of opal known for its soft, pastel pink color. The stone is found in Peru, where it is found in veins and layers within the rock. Unlike precious opals, which are renowned for their vibrant iridescence, Pink Opal has a smooth, subdued sheen. This is sometimes interrupted by cream-colored markings.
